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)
$5,000 - $12,000 (Lar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Walkway Demolition |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Driveway Demolition | $2,500 - $7,000 |
| Patio Demolition | $1,500 - $4,500 |
| Concrete Removal | $1,200 - $3,500 |
| Sidewalk Removal |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Driveway Replacement | $8,000 - $20,000 |

Walkway demolition in Melrose Park, IL, involves removing existing concrete or paving materials to prepare for new installation or to clear space for other improvements.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this service.
- Materials involved: Typically includes concrete, asphalt, or paving stones, depending on the existing walkway.
- Size and scope: Ranges from small residential paths to larger commercial walkways, influencing overall project complexity.
- Labor complexity: Varies based on walkway thickness, material type, and accessibility, affecting the removal process.
- Permitting requirements: Local regulations in Melrose Park may require permits, especially for larger or public projects.
- Additional considerations: Disposal of debris, potential reinforcement removal, and site cleanup are common extras to consider.
Project size impacts overall pricing, from small repairs to large demolitions.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ential walkway (up to 50 sq ft)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Medium walkway (50 - 150 sq ft) |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Large commercial walkway (over 150 sq ft) | $6,000 - $15,000 |
| Additional features (e.g., reinforcement, removal of debris) | Varies, typically $500 - $2,000 |
